生态承载力是指一个生态系统在特定时期内,能够持续支持一定数量和类型的生物种群的能力。这个概念对于理解人与自然的关系至关重要,因为人类活动对自然环境的影响日益加剧。本文将探讨生态承载力的概念、评估方法,以及如何在实践中实现人与自然的和谐共生。
生态承载力的概念
生态承载力是一个多维度的概念,它包括以下几个方面:
- 生物承载力:指生态系统对生物种群的数量和种类的支持能力。
- 资源承载力:指生态系统提供食物、水、空气等基本资源的能力。
- 环境承载力:指生态系统对污染和干扰的容忍程度。
生态承载力是有限的,而人类的需求是不断增长的,这就要求我们必须在满足人类需求的同时,保护生态环境,实现可持续发展。
生态承载力的评估方法
评估生态承载力通常需要以下几个步骤:
- 数据收集:收集有关生态系统、生物种群、资源消耗和环境质量的统计数据。
- 模型构建:利用生态学、统计学和数学模型,对数据进行分析和模拟。
- 情景分析:对不同的发展情景进行模拟,预测未来生态承载力的变化。
- 风险评估:评估人类活动对生态承载力的影响,以及可能带来的风险。
以下是一个简单的生态承载力评估模型的示例代码:
import numpy as np
def ecological_capacity(model_params):
"""
生态承载力评估模型。
:param model_params: 模型参数,包括生物承载力、资源承载力、环境承载力等。
:return: 生态承载力评估结果。
"""
# 计算生态承载力
ecological_capacity = np.dot(model_params['biological'], model_params['resource']) * model_params['environment']
return ecological_capacity
# 示例参数
params = {
'biological': np.array([100, 200]), # 生物承载力
'resource': np.array([150, 250]), # 资源承载力
'environment': 1.0 # 环境承载力
}
# 评估生态承载力
capacity = ecological_capacity(params)
print(f"生态承载力评估结果:{capacity}")
实现人与自然的和谐共生之道
为了实现人与自然的和谐共生,我们可以采取以下措施:
- 可持续发展:在经济发展过程中,注重环境保护和资源节约,实现经济效益、社会效益和环境效益的统一。
- 生态保护:加强生态保护区的建设和管理,保护生物多样性和生态平衡。
- 绿色生活:倡导绿色生活方式,减少对环境的污染和破坏。
- 科技创新:利用科技手段,提高资源利用效率,减少对环境的压力。
总之,生态承载力是衡量人与自然关系的重要指标。通过科学评估和实践探索,我们可以找到实现人与自然和谐共生之道,为子孙后代留下一个美好的家园。
